About Liguo Xu
Liguo Xu is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Organic Chemistry, Polymers and Plastics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 33 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Sensor and Energy Harvesting Materials (6 papers),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(6 papers), Catalytic Cross-Coupling Reactions (4 papers), Dendrimers and Hyperbranched Polymers (4 papers), Conducting polymers and applications (3 papers), Organoboron and organosilicon chemistry (3 papers), Click Chemistry and Applications (3 papers) and Nuclear materials and radiation effects (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Polymers and Plastics (451 citations), Biomedical Engineering (605 citations), Biomaterials (181 citations), Spectroscopy (200 citations) and Surfaces, Coatings and Films (84 citations). Liguo Xu has collaborated with scholars based in China, Hong Kong and United States. Frequent co-authors include Zhenkai Huang, Kan Yue, Zihao Guo, Zhukang Du, Tao Lin Sun, Rongrong Hu, Ben Zhong Tang, Guangzhao Zhang, Anjun Qin and Chunfeng Ma. Their work appears in journals such as Polymer Chemistry, Macromolecules, ACS Macro Letters, Journal of Nuclear Materials and Materials.
